This picture is\u00a0<a href=\"http:\/\/www.jhi.pl\/en\/institute\/history\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">from its website<\/a>:<\/p>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/mcusercontent.com\/bc493816d894ee14ba9103e7b\/images\/877faf99-0bfc-44d0-874c-0c7c295cb0a3.jpeg\" width=\"714\" height=\"427\" align=\"center\" data-file-id=\"1843020\" \/><\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align: center;\"><span style=\"color: #2f4f4f; font-family: open sans, helvetica neue, helvetica, arial, sans-serif;\">This is how it looks like today in Google Maps:<\/span><\/div>\n<div><span style=\"color: #2f4f4f; font-family: open sans, helvetica neue, helvetica, arial, sans-serif;\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/mcusercontent.com\/bc493816d894ee14ba9103e7b\/images\/8569070a-e135-44bd-a6c7-9429f4eb84bc.png\" width=\"712\" height=\"297\" data-file-id=\"1843048\" \/><\/span><\/div>\n<div><span style=\"font-family: 'open sans', 'helvetica neue', helvetica, arial, sans-serif; font-size: 11pt;\">The cornerstone of the Great Synagogue was laid in a ceremony held on 14 May 1876. The architect was Leandro Marconi, who also built the Synagogue No\u017cyk\u00f3w, the only one that survived the\u00a0World War II (more info,\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/warszawa.jewish.org.pl\/en\/religion\/nozyk-synagogue\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">at the website of Jewish.org.pl)<\/a>. The grand opening and consecration of the synagogue took place on the day of Rosh Hashanah of the year 5639 (on 26 September 1878). In fact he does, but note that the singer in this animation is accredited to be another superb cantor, also born in Ukraine, but about whom I haven&#8217;t found references of his presence in Warsaw at the Great Synagogue: Yossele Rosenblatt, who will be our star in a future MBS &#8211;&gt;<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div><strong>Anyway, immerse yourself in the Great Synagogue!\u00a0<\/strong><\/div>\n<div><\/div>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/qerOiePBcBM\" width=\"700\" height=\"420\" frameborder=\"0\" allowfullscreen=\"allowfullscreen\"><span data-mce-type=\"bookmark\" style=\"display: inline-block; width: 0px; overflow: hidden; line-height: 0;\" class=\"mce_SELRES_start\">\ufeff<\/span><span data-mce-type=\"bookmark\" style=\"display: inline-block; width: 0px; overflow: hidden; line-height: 0;\" class=\"mce_SELRES_start\">\ufeff<\/span><\/iframe><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: center;\"><span style=\"color: #2f4f4f; font-family: playfair display, georgia, times new roman, serif;\"><strong>The great chazzan at the most prestigious position in the cantorial world<\/strong><\/span><\/h3>\n<h6>Gershon Sirota became the Obercantor in the Great Synagogue in 1907. The World War II brought\u00a0the end of the Synagogue and also of Sirota.<\/h6>\n<p>According to Rabbi Geoffrey Shisler,\u00a0<em>&#8220;Not without good reason was Gershon Sirota spoken of as the &#8216;Jewish Caruso.&#8217; Even with the poor quality recordings that we have of him today, it&#8217;s quite clear that he had a most extraordinary voice and since he was a contemporary of Caruso (1873 &#8211; 1938), the comparison was bound to be made. An apocryphal story has it that Caruso would come to hear Sirota sing or conduct a service whenever\u00a0they were in the same town at the same time.<\/em>&#8221;<\/p>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ft\" src=\"https:\/\/mcusercontent.com\/bc493816d894ee14ba9103e7b\/images\/052a689c-6ae9-41cb-8bda-8d092ad2c0d7.jpg\" width=\"250\" height=\"327\" align=\"left\" data-file-id=\"1843256\" \/>Gershon\u00a0was born in Podolia in 1874. His father was a cantor in the local synagogue and, already as a child, Gershon helped his father in the services. The family moved to Odessa, where he would be\u00a0cantor in Shalashner Shul. Later he gave service at the\u00a0Shtat Synagogue of Vilna. His performances granted him more and more popularity and was called to make special concerts in many cities around, first in Russia and Poland, and later much further.\u00a0<strong>He was\u00a0the first cantor to record his voice on phonograph records and he became world famous thanks to this.\u00a0<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Between 1912 and 1927 he toured in many ocassions at the USA. It made him lose his position in the Great Synagogue, because he was absent too much time, specially in the High Holy Days. No problem. He was already a very demanded star.<\/p>\n<p>He toured at the USA for his last time in 1938. It is sad that he didn&#8217;t decide to stay there. He had to return to Warsaw because his wife was very ill. The start of the war found him there. The family was imprisoned in the Guetto, where he would conduct the High Holy Day services in 1941.<\/p>\n<p>In the first months of 1943, a strong resistence arised in the\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/encyclopedia.ushmm.org\/content\/en\/article\/warsaw-ghetto-uprising\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Guetto of Warsaw and an uprising started on April 19<\/a>. The bombing of our Synagogue, that\u00a0was out of the Guetto, was the symbol of the end of that\u00a0uprising. Sirota was murdered with his family in\u00a0the last day of Pessah, during the destruction of the Guetto.<\/p>\n<p>The sources for this brief bio have been:\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/jewish-music.huji.ac.il\/content\/gershon-sirota\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Jewish Music Research Center<\/a>,\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/holocaustmusic.ort.org\/fr\/places\/ghettos\/warsaw\/sirota-gershon\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Music and the Holocaust<\/a>.<\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: center;\"><span style=\"color: #2f4f4f; font-family: playfair display, georgia, times new roman, serif;\"><strong>The\u00a0voice of the &#8220;Jewish Caruso&#8221;<\/strong><\/span><\/h3>\n<div>I have chosen his rendition of Avinu\u00a0Maikenu.
